What this job involves: We're seeking a dedicated Analyst to provide general marketing and analytical support to the Industrial Agency Team to increase their effectiveness and financial performance in the Commercial market. In this dynamic role, you will learn and eventually demonstrate a strong understanding of the property market specific to industrial sales and leasing, with the ambition to transition into an Agency role. Here's a snapshot of the role: Responsible to maintaining all data input for the entire industrial team Create and maintain all property listings in internal database Manage all property marketing material Work closely with other support staff to ensure timely and accurate work Liaise with various external and internal stakeholders to write and produce detailed property marketing reports. Produce advertising material for press advertising and online content. Assume overall responsibility for the creation and delivery of top quality pitch documents for major assets, primarily in the commercial sector. Source, collect and collate sales evidence as is and preparation of detailed Sales Analyses. Sound like you? This is what we're looking for: Ideally (but not necessary), you will be a graduate or currently studying a Property/similar based Degree with optional property experience an advantageous. You will absolutely need to have excellent work ethic and desire to progress within the business as well as prioritise tasks.
